Solution for What is 415 increased by 30 percent? (415 plus 30%):

415 + (30/100 * 415) = 539.5

Now we have: 415 increased by 30 percent = 539.5

Question: What is 415 increased by 30 percent?

Percentage solution with steps:

Step 1: We have a with value of 415.

Step 2: We have b with value of 30.

Step 3: The formula for calculation will be: a + (b/100 * a) = x.

Step 4: We could also represent this as: x = a + (\frac{b}{100} * a).

Step 5: We now replace with the values: x = 415 + (\frac{30}{100} * 415).

Step 6: That gives us an {x} = {539.5}

Therefore, {415} increased by {30\%} is {539.5}
